It's time for Saints vs. Buccaneers II.

While the headlines might naturally gravitate to the two future hall of famers quarterbacking both squads, there's a lot more on the line in this game than a duel between Drew Brees and Tom Brady.

A win this week could make certain the Saints' path to a fourth straight division crown, and the playoffs, much easier.

Get important gameday information, including how to watch, stream and follow the game, below.



When: Sunday, Nov. 8 (7:20 p.m. CT)

Series record: Saints lead, 36-21.

Last meeting: 2020, Saints win, 34-23

Bucs in 2020: 6-2, 1st in NFC South.

NUMBERS TO KNOW
0: Tom Brady has never been swept by a division opponent.

14: The Buccaneers have 14 takeaways this season, a mark that leads the league.

81: That's the number of Antonio Brown, who will be playing in his first game as a Buccaneer on Sunday.

100: The Saints' defense hasn't allowed a 100-yard rusher since Week 11 of the 2017 season. That's 50 straight games.


FOUR THINGS TO WATCH FOR
1. Brees vs. Brady II

Drew Brees got the victory in the first meeting of the season between the 2 first-ballot Hall of Famers. But Brees did so despite having his worst outing of the season. He completed 18 of 30 passes for a season-low 160 yards and 2 touchdowns. The Buccaneers defense is one of the best units in the league, allowing just 299.5 yards per game, which is the third best in the league. They rank 13th in the league against the pass, allowing 229.1 yards through the air. The past three games, that number has dropped to 211 per game. Brees has found his groove the past few weeks. How well he does against the Bucs' D will be pivotal.

2. Grounded

Running the ball may be a challenge for both teams. We've been talking about the Saints' streak of not allowing a 100-yard rusher since Nov. of 2017, which was the last time an opposing back eclipsed the century mark. That streak is now at 50 games and the Saints are allowing just 90.6 yards per game on the ground. As impressive as the Saints' run defense has been for the past three seasons, it's the Bucs who are leading the NFL in stuffing the run this season. They are yielding just 70.4 yards per game. Can Alvin Kamara and Latavius Murray , who have combined to average 101 yards per game, get it done on ground?


3. Marshon Lattimore vs. Mike Evans: An intensen rivalry

It's one of the more intense individual rivalries in the NFL, dating back to Marshon Lattimore's rookie season when Bucs' receiver Mike Evans shoved him, setting off an altercation during the two times. Since then, Lattimore has pretty much dominated in his matchups against Evans, including this year's season opener. Tom Brady targeted Evans twice in that game, but he didn't have any receptions. According to NFL.com’s Next Gen Stats, Lattimore was matched up with Evans 29 times in the game. It'll be one of the more intriguing one-on-one matchups to watch once again.

4. An NFC South 4-peat?
No team has ever won the NFC South in four consecutive seasons. The Saints are hoping to be the first to do so this season. The Saints are currently a half game behind the Bucs in the standings, so winning this one could go a long way in determining which team wins the division. This one would also help in tie-breaker scenarios because it would give the Saints a season sweep in a division that looks to be a 2-team race. Both teams have favorable schedules after Sunday.
